Show S Labor Saving Increases 5 In 1855 it took 38 hours and 45 minutes to produce an acre of corn. Now it takes five hours and 21 minutes. That the labor saving from farm machinery has been 'jrogresive is shown by comparison compari-son with a more recent year. In 1942 total farm production was more than a third greater than in 1919 although there were 6.5 per cent fewer persons on the farm to accomplish it. In 1942 each farm fed six more persons than 23 years before, and the income per person on farms was 22 per cent greater. To have harvested our 1942 wheat chop by the methods of 1850 would have meant using very able-bodied person in the United States and also importing millions of foreign hands. |
